India part of the World's largest ever nuclear energy project worth over $ 20 billion.


After the Mission to Mars; yet another feather in the cap of the scientific R&D of India; with India being roped in to a massive the largest ever global nuclear energy project in Southern France, the first state-of-art nuclear reactor to produce clean energy by fusing atoms, like that happens on the Sun.

The International Thermonuclear Experimental Reactor (ITER) brings together India, China, South Korea, USA, Japan, Russia and the European Union to be part of this prestigious project whose estimated budget runs over $20 billion. It is worth noting that these countries constitute half of the global human population and accounts for two thirds of global economic might.

This reactor weighs 23,000 tons as much as 3 times of the weight of the Eiffel Tower and about 80,000 kms of special super conducting wires go for this making. This reactor will have nuclear research work imbibed to produce any hazardous nuclear waste but only helium, a noble gas or water, using fusion energy or ever green atomic energy. By next year, the team will be able to come out with a firm dead line on the completion of this project.

India is providing one tenth of the components needed for this massive nuclear complex unfolding at Cadarache, France, besides Rs 9000 crores, roughly one tenth of the project cost; which in all likely hood be the largest refrigerator by 2021. Once it is in place, the world can harvest energy directly from the Sun and India can for fusion reactors in due course.
